What does maintaining good communication among responding units ensure?

Maintaining good communication among responding units is crucial for coordinating actions and ensuring overall safety during emergency operations. Effective communication allows units to share vital information about conditions at the scene, resources needed, and their respective locations. This coordination helps to avoid misunderstandings that could lead to accidents or operational failures.

When units communicate clearly, they can work together more efficiently, strategizing their approach to the incident while responding to dynamic conditions. This mutual awareness not only maximizes the effectiveness of the response but also safeguards the safety of both responders and civilians. This aspect of communication is pivotal in any emergency situation, where the rapid exchange of information can significantly influence the outcome of the response efforts.

In contrast, while faster arrival to the scene, accurate paperwork completion, and reduction of dispatched vehicles are all important, they do not directly encompass the critical aspects of incident management and safety that effective communication covers. Thus, the primary focus of maintaining good communication is on coordination and the overall well-being of the team and those they serve.
